80C51 8-bit microcontroller family 1K/64 OTP ROM, low pin count DESCRIPTION The Philips 8XC750 offers the advantages of the 80C51 architecture in a small package and at low cost. The 8XC750 Microcontroller is fabricated with Philips high-density CMOS technology. Philips epitaxial substrate minimizes CMOS latch-up sensitivity.
